Pune, June 15, 2026: Ashwini Vaishnaw, Minister of Railways, Information & Broadcasting and Electronics & Information Technology, will flag off the Pune-Sainagar Shirdi Daily Express from Pune Railway Station in the august presence of various dignitaries on 17.06.2026 at 15.30 hrs.
This will be the 1st direct train from Pune to Sainagar Shirdi, fulfilling a long-standing demand of devotees and tourists.

Sainagar Shirdi:
Shirdi, located in Ahilyanagar district, is one of the most revered pilgrimage centres in India, being the abode of Shri Saibaba. Sainagar Shirdi Railway Station serves lakhs of devotees visiting the holy shrine through out the year from all parts of the country. The new direct connectivity from Pune will provide major convenience to pilgrims and boost religious tourism in the region.
Pune-Sainagar Shirdi Express:
Benefits
• This will be the 1st direct train from Pune to Shirdi.
• It will offer a safe, affordable, and comfortable option for passengers, especially senior citizens, families, and group tours visiting Saibaba Temple, reducing travel fatigue for elderly devotees.
• The service will also improve access for Ahilyanagar and Shirdi residents to Pune’s educational and medical facilities, while boosting the local economy around Shirdi through increased footfall for hotels, taxis, and vendors.
• Major halts enroute include
Daund Chord Cabin-ensuring seamless rapid transit for local passengers between Pune-Daund line and north bound Daund –Manmad line, Shrigonda-providing affordable and fast connectivity to local farmers, traders and students.
Ahilyanagar-is a massive administrative, military and commercial hub handling thousands of daily commuters, working professionals and military personnel.
Rahuri- is a renowned educational and agricultural centre, home to the largest agricultural university in the State, Mahatma Phule Krishi Vidapeeth. A halt here will immensely benefit hundreds of students, researchers and scientists travelling to & fro to the University. It also facilitate travel for local farmers.
Belapur houses some of the region’s pioneering sugar mills and is the preferred gateway to the famous Shani Shingapur Temple.
